Channels are the central concept for connectivity, data processing, and automation in Lucanet Banking & Cash Management (BCM). Channels are the interfaces between BCM and external data sources, transform data into different formats, and control the execution of automated business processes.
Each channel is configured for a specific task — for example, fetching account statements via EBICS, converting Excel files into SEPA payments, or automatically calculating cash forecasts. Channels start time-controlled via recurring jobs or event-driven via processing rules; you can also trigger channels manually.
Communication channels enable unidirectional or bidirectional data exchange with external systems and partners, depending on the channel type. Communication channels establish secure connections to banks, exchange files with ERP systems, and send notifications via different communication paths.
Transformation channels convert data between different formats and standards and adapt data structures to the requirements of different systems and processes.
Processing channels automate complex business processes and execute rule-based actions. The channels orchestrate workflows, calculate financial information, and integrate different system components.
Import channels are internal technical processes that control the automated import of different data types. BCM provides import channels by default; if necessary, you can duplicate and adapt import channels.

Schedules define on which weekdays and at which times recurring jobs are executed. In this workspace, you create and manage schedules. A schedule takes effect as soon as you assign it to the respective job — this way you avoid executions outside business hours.
Encryption methods encrypt and decrypt data that is exchanged via channels: BCM encrypts the data before sending and decrypts the data after receiving. You assign encryption methods to target channels to protect sensitive information.
Processing rules monitor jobs. When a job reaches the status defined in the rule, the rule triggers the linked channels and thus chains processes without manual intervention.
